A water utility company in Aldershot is seeking a skilled individual to oversee the repair, maintenance, and installation of PLCs and HMIs. The ideal candidate will bring experience in PLC programming and hardware along with strong fault-finding skills. This role involves supervising contractors and ensuring the security and operational reliability of production sites. Flexibility and adaptability are crucial as this position includes on-call duties. A competitive salary up to £61,121 is offered, along with an attractive benefits package.
